a)   Each International Searching Authority carrying out supplementary international searches may require that the applicant pay a fee (“supplementary search fee”) for its own benefit for carrying out such a search.

b)   The supplementary search fee shall be collected by the International Bureau. Rules 16.1(b) to (e) shall apply mutatis mutandis.

c)   As to the time limit for payment of the supplementary search fee and the amount payable, the provisions of Rule 45bis.2(c) shall apply mutatis mutandis.

d)   The International Bureau shall refund the supplementary search fee to the applicant if, before the documents referred to in Rule 45bis.4(e)(i) to (iv) are transmitted to the Authority specified for supplementary search, the international application is withdrawn or considered withdrawn, or the supplementary search request is withdrawn or is considered not to have been submitted under Rules 45bis.1(e) or 45bis.4(d).

e)   The Authority specified for supplementary search shall, to the extent and under the conditions provided for in the applicable agreement under Article 16(3)(b), refund the supplementary search fee if, before it has started the supplementary international search in accordance with Rule 45bis.5(a), the supplementary search request is considered not to have been submitted under Rule 45bis.5(g).
